SQL Server
文章平均质量分 69
zhangbosun
这个作者很懒,什么都没留下…
展开
-
SQL创建计划任务
在数据库的应用系统中,充分的利用数据库的后台服务端的功能可以可以简化客户端前台的工作,更可以降低网络的负荷,同时使整个系统设计更合理,便于维护移植和升级,后台计划任务作业在很多数据库应用中经常会用到,当然是配合存储过程使用。 在SQL Server2000中,可以手动一步一步的在企业管理器中建立后台计划任务作业,但这样既麻烦也不便于发布,因此本文给出使用T-SQL脚本创建作业的方法。 需要下面转载 2007-06-21 12:56:00 · 1765 阅读 · 0 评论 -
sql 重复记录和重复记录数
如果TABLE1有两个column adress和pepole,那么下面的SQL可以找出TABLE1里的重复记录和重复记录数 create table TABLE1(adress nvarchar(10),pepole nvarchar(10))insert TABLE1 select 宁波, 张三(NB)union all select 宁波, 李四(NB)uni原创 2007-05-30 15:58:00 · 1733 阅读 · 0 评论 -
sql server的基于日期的算法集合
参考以下日期写法---求相差天数select datediff(day,2004-01-01,getdate())转贴:--1.一个月第一天的SELECT DATEADD(mm, DATEDIFF(mm,0,getdate()), 0)--2.本周的星期一SELECT DATEADD(wk, DATEDIFF(wk,0,getdate()), 0)select dateadd(wk转载 2007-05-24 20:02:00 · 606 阅读 · 0 评论 -
sql server datetime 与char之间的装换
说明:此样式一般在时间类型(datetime,smalldatetime)与字符串类型(nchar,nvarchar,char,varchar)相互转换的时候才用到.语句及查询结果:SELECT CONVERT(varchar(100), GETDATE(), 0): 05 16 2006 10:57AMSELECT CONVERT(varchar(100), GETDATE(), 1): 0转载 2007-05-24 20:00:00 · 717 阅读 · 0 评论 -
行列转换(将表旋转90度)
普通行列转换 假设有张学生成绩表(t)如下 Name Subject Result 张三 语文 73 张三 数学 83 张三 物理 93 李四 语文 74 李四 数学 84转载 2007-05-25 09:56:00 · 998 阅读 · 2 评论 -
精典的SQL语句,推荐收藏
在网上经常转,常常看到有些人为了求得某些SQL语句而焦头烂额,现在我特别把自己收藏的一些比较精典的SQL拿出来和大家分享一下1. 行列转换--普通假设有张学生成绩表(CJ)如下Name Subject Result张三 语文 80张三 数学 90张三 物理 85李四 语文 85李四 数学转载 2007-05-24 20:09:00 · 649 阅读 · 0 评论 -
表的合并,两个表合并入第三个表
现有一个表:表Aadress pepole宁波 张三(NB)宁波 李四(NB)宁波 王五(NB)杭州 张三(HZ)杭州 李四(HZ)杭州 王五(HZ)转化为表表BNBpepole HZpepole张三(NB) 张三(HZ)李四(NB) 李四(HZ)王五(NB) 王五(HZ)方法一:create table T(adress nvarchar(10),pepole原创 2007-05-24 19:44:00 · 836 阅读 · 0 评论 -
存储过程中根据参数的空值与否拼接语句
题:存储过程有4个参数,1个是数据表名,3个是数据字段, 在这3个数据字段中,至少有一个数据字段参数不为空。我的方式是:由于有3个不确定空值与否的参数,查询语句也不确定,可以根据判断,得出查询语句。存储过程我是这样写的if exists (select name from sysobjects where name = MyProcedurePD and type = p)原创 2007-05-24 19:41:00 · 1473 阅读 · 1 评论 -
表结构的转换(横->竖)
现有一个表:表Aadress pepole宁波 张三(NB)宁波 李四(NB)宁波 王五(NB)杭州 张三(HZ)杭州 李四(HZ)杭州 王五(HZ)转化为表表BNBpepole HZpepole张三(NB) 张三(HZ)李四(NB) 李四(HZ)王五(NB) 王五(HZ)/*现有一个表:表Tadress pepole宁波 张三(NB)宁波 李四(NB)宁波原创 2007-05-22 09:30:00 · 599 阅读 · 0 评论 -
SQL 经典使用
关于索引,推荐转载的这篇文章http://blog.csdn.net/dutguoyi/archive/2006/01/10/575617.aspx改善SQL语句的效率http://community.csdn.net/Expert/topic/5087/5087396.xml?temp=.345669数据量很大怎样加快索检速度http://community.csdn.net/Expert/转载 2007-05-05 12:29:00 · 597 阅读 · 0 评论 -
SQL智能完成工具
SQL Prompt™ 针对SQL Server的智能感知工具。 SQL Prompt 为Microsoft SQL Server 编辑器提供一种智能感知形式的自动完成功能,当你正在写你自己的SQL命令时,它也会告诉你应该使用正确的格式,帮助你快速地写出格式良好的SQL语句。SQL Prompt会提升你创建任何S转载 2007-05-05 10:15:00 · 583 阅读 · 0 评论 -
通用分页存储过程
好久没有上来写点东西了,今天正好有空,共享一些个人心得,就是关于分页的存储过程,这个问题应该是老生重谈了,网上的通用存储过程的类型已经够多了,但是,好象看到的基本上不能够满足一些复杂的SQL语句的分页(也可能是我不够见多识广啊,呵呵),比如下面这句:select as CheckBox, A.TargetID, A.TargetPeriod, Convert(varchar(1转载 2007-06-19 15:53:00 · 777 阅读 · 0 评论